Language

The official languages of Belgium are Dutch, French, and German. However, English is widely spoken in tourist areas.

Currency

The currency of Belgium is the euro (€).

What to Eat

Belgium is famous for its waffles, chocolate, and beer. Here are some of the must-try dishes:

  • Waffles: Waffles are a popular breakfast food in Belgium. They can be served with a variety of toppings, such as fruit, whipped cream, or chocolate sauce.
  • Chocolate: Belgium is known for its delicious chocolate. There are many chocolate shops in Brussels, where you can buy a variety of chocolates, including truffles, pralines, and bars.
  • Beer: Belgium is also famous for its beer. There are over 1,500 different types of beer produced in Belgium. Some of the most popular beers include Stella Artois, Leffe, and Hoegaarden.

Where to Go

There are many things to see and do in Belgium. Here are some of the most popular tourist destinations:

  • Brussels: Brussels is the capital of Belgium. It is a vibrant city with a rich history and culture. There are many museums, art galleries, and historical sites to visit in Brussels.
  • Bruges: Bruges is a beautiful medieval city in Belgium. It is known for its canals, bridges, and cobblestone streets. Bruges is a popular tourist destination, and it is easy to see why.
  • Antwerp: Antwerp is a major port city in Belgium. It is known for its fashion, diamonds, and art. Antwerp is a great city to visit for shopping and sightseeing.
